§ 36.61.210 — Special assessments—Subdivision of land—Segregation of assessment.

Whenever any land against which there has been levied any special assessment or annual special assessments by any county has been sold in part, subdivided, or short subdivided, the county legislative authority may order a segregation of the special assessment or annual special assessments. If an installment has been made, the segregation shall apportion the remaining installments on the parts or lots created.
Any person desiring to have such a special assessment or annual special assessments against a tract of land segregated to apply to smaller parts thereof shall apply to the county legislative authority which levied the special assessment or annual special assessments.
